Flamenco Latino

Flamenco Latino was established in New York in 1979 by Basilio and Aurora. At the time Aurora was studying to be a Flamenco dancer and Basilio was playing bass for Latin bands. Flamenco Latino was designed to blend Hispanic and Spanish cultural styles and draws on the rich Hispanic artist population of New York City for highly skilled performers.
